默契
Sammi Cheng
"默契" is a different kind of Sammi Cheng entirely — lighter on its feet, built for motion rather than stillness. The arrangement carries a breezy mid-tempo confidence, guitars and light synth textures giving it a slightly coastal feel, the kind of late-afternoon sound that moves with you rather than demanding you stop and listen. What anchors it emotionally is the specific subject matter: not falling in love, not heartbreak, but the quieter miracle of being understood by another person without having to explain yourself. The Cantonese word 默契 doesn't translate cleanly — it implies a wordless synchrony, a shared frequency — and the song earns its title by actually capturing that feeling rather than merely naming it. Sammi's vocal delivery has a kind of ease here, a comfortable warmth that's distinct from her more formally emotive ballad work. She sounds like she means it without having to work to convince you. The verses feel like a conversation and the chorus feels like punctuation — a moment of mutual recognition. This is music for a relationship that has reached the phase past romance and into something rarer: the stage where two people stop performing for each other and just exist. It plays well in the car, in the morning, with someone who doesn't need you to talk.
